Summary of Streamex (STEX) Q1 2026 Earnings Call

1. Key Financial Results and Metrics

  • Cash and Investments: Closed the quarter with $45.85 million in cash and investments.
  • Comprehensive Loss: Reported a comprehensive loss of $48.6 million, primarily due to noncash items: $25.4 million in stock-based compensation and $12.2 million related to convertible debenture retirement.
  • Assets and Liabilities: Total assets were $173.3 million, with total liabilities reduced to $14 million after retiring $50 million in convertible debt.
  • AUM: GLDY, the newly launched tokenized gold product, had an AUM of 3,096.6 ounces (approximately $14 million).

2. Strategic Updates and Business Highlights

  • Product Launch: Successfully launched GLDY, marking the company's transition from preparation to execution.
  • Dividends: Paid first dividends totaling 10.48 ounces of gold to GLDY holders.
  • Partnership Ecosystem: Established partnerships with key players like Equity Trust (IRA custodian), Wintermute (liquidity provider), and Orca (decentralized exchange) to enhance distribution and trading capabilities.
  • Operational Improvements: Resolved KYC integration issues that previously slowed onboarding, with a dedicated sales team now addressing backlog sign-ups.

3. Forward Guidance and Outlook

  • Revenue Expectations: Anticipate modest revenue in the near term as GLDY ramps up AUM and secondary trading infrastructure becomes operational.
  • Future Product Launches: Plans to launch GLDC (tokenized gold product) and SLVC (tokenized silver product) in Q3 2026, focusing on scaling GLDY functionality first.
  • Market Potential: The tokenized real-world assets market is projected to reach $16 trillion by 2030, with Streamex positioned to capitalize on this growth.

4. Bad News, Challenges, or Points of Concern

  • Initial AUM Growth: GLDY's AUM growth has been slower than expected, leading to some downward pressure on the stock.
  • Operational Hiccups: Early operational issues related to KYC integration delayed onboarding, although these have now been resolved.
  • Market Sentiment: There is cautious sentiment among traditional asset managers, with some waiting for further regulatory clarity before committing to tokenized products.

5. Notable Q&A Insights

  • Growth Milestones: Management emphasized that operational milestones, such as successful partnerships and product functionality, are critical for driving AUM growth.
  • Regulatory Clarity: There is optimism that upcoming regulatory clarity will enhance market confidence and potentially accelerate adoption of tokenized assets.
  • Liquidity Enhancements: The partnership with Wintermute will enable instant liquidity for GLDY, reducing the purchase and redemption timeline from T+2 to T+0, which is expected to attract more investors.
  • Institutional Distribution: The integration with Equity Trust opens access to $72 billion in U.S. tax-advantaged retirement accounts, significantly expanding the potential investor base for GLDY.

Overall, while Streamex has made significant strides in product development and partnership building, it faces challenges in scaling AUM and navigating market sentiment. The upcoming quarters will be crucial for demonstrating the viability of its business model and achieving growth targets.
